As Senior Facilities Co-ordinator you'll be responsible for providing an efficient, effective and flexible facilities management service across your site, ensuring the highest standards are delivered and maintained.
What it's like to work here
The beauty of Stowe and the surrounding area has attracted visitors for over 300 years and the wider portfolio includes Claydon House, a medieval tower and duck decoy at Boarstall, Long Crendon Courthouse and Buckingham Chantry Chapel. Along with the friendly team, this area is a great place to work!
What you'll be doing
This role is responsible for providing an efficient, effective and flexible facilities management service to enable the successful operation of your site You will work collaboratively with other team members to deliver excellent standards in maintenance, presentation and customer service.
Working within the appropriate Trust procedures and conservation guidelines, you will ensure your site is well maintained to a high standard at all times. You will promote Health & Safety awareness across the property and for ensuring effective environmental management is sustained.

Who we're looking for
To deliver this role successfully, you’ll need to demonstrate the following experience on your CV/application:
* Understanding of facilities and / or building management, maintenance & provision of services, supported by relevant professional qualification (or equivalent level of vocational experience).
* Good knowledge and experience of Health and Safety, Emergency Procedures, Fire and Security procedures and legislation
* Knowledge and experience of managing budgets, finances, projects and contracts
* Experience of records management and information systems and advanced IT skills (Microsoft Office).
We'd love to hear from you if you:
* Are a good team player with experience of supervising others
* Have an understanding of working with volunteers and knowledge of the framework that the Trust uses to support the volunteer journey.
* Have excellent people and customer service skills, enabling strong relationships to be built and maintained externally and internally.
* Have excellent written and verbal communication skills including influencing, negotiating and presentation
